1. Where is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da?
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da, also known as Huyen Khong 2 Pagoda, is a famous spiritual place in Hue, which combines the beauty of nature and ancient architecture.
- Location: Cham Village, Huong Ho Ward, Huong Tra Town, Thua Thien Hue Province
The pagoda is situated about 11 kilometers to the west of Hue’s city center. 2. The history of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da Hue
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da is one of the most sacred sites in Hue with a long history. As per records, the development history of this pagoda is as follows:
- 1976: Zen master Vien Minh was nominated to be the abbot of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da
- 1978: The pagoda was relocated to Huong Ho Ward from Hai Van, Lang Co – its former location
- 1992: Zen master Phap Tong became the abbot of the pagoda

3. Things to do on your trip to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da
3.1. Walk around and enjoy the tranquility at the pagoda
The scenery of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da is made of a breathtaking view and tranquil atmosphere. The pagoda includes:
- The stone garden: The total area of the garden is about 500 square meters, with lush green grass and greystones
- The five lakes: Namely, Thuy Nguyet Dam, Son Anh, Vong Oa Dam, and 2 other lakes scattered in the pagoda’s grounds. Each lake has a poetic bridge crossing over.
- The calligraphy house: located opposite a pine hill, this house displays calligraphy that varies according to the 4 seasons of the year.
3.2. Admire the prominent architectural works of the pagoda
- The main hall: This is a simple house with a mahogany tiled roof, featuring the traditional architectural style of Vietnam. This hall is used to worship Shakyamuni Buddha. On two sides are statues of Xa Loi Phat, Muc Kieu Lien, and many other saints. At the back is a big calligraphic work and two flower vases.
- Nghinh Luong Temple: This temple is renowned for its open space, crocheted tiles, and mixed woods. It is where visitors can take a rest and enjoy tea. The temple grounds is covered by orchids and frangipanis.
- Purple Cloud Shrine: This area includes a living quarter, a guest room, a calligraphy room, and a study room of the abbot.
- Tinh Trai House: This is the kitchen of the pagoda, with an area of 120 square meters.
- The guest house: This is where tourists can take a seat and relax after exploring the pagoda. This is also where monks, nuns, and people who want to learn about Buddhism gather.

4. The best guide for your sightseeing trip to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da
4.1. How to get to the pagoda?
- Means of transportation: You can go by motorbike or taxi to reach the pagoda.
- How to get to the pagoda: From Hue’s city center, go to Kim Long Street. Pass by Thien Mu Pagoda to Van Thanh, cross over Xuoc Du Bridge, and keep going until you arrive at Cham Village. Continue on for about 250 meters and you will see a signboard, which shows the pagoda to be 3 kilometers away.
4.2. What to note during your visit?
There are some things that tourists should keep in mind when visiting Huyen Khong Son Thuong Pagoda:
- Check the map before going, as this pagoda is situated in the outskirt of the city, surrounded by rice fields and forests
- Wear appropriate and non-revealing clothes
- Do not give the monks donation, put it in the donation boxes instead
